# Quillbrook Environments: Report Export Timezones

Quillbrook runs three environments: dev, staging, and prod. Report exports are rendered server-side, so the timezone is taken from the environment config, not the user's browser. Dev and staging are pinned to UTC; prod uses the tenant's declared region. If a contractor sees off-by-hours timestamps, check the environment first. Each environment declares its export timezone settings in the service config shown below.

service settings:
HOLDOR_PIN=6477
HOLDOR_METRICS_HOST=metrics.holdor.nelvrocorp.corp
HOLDOR_LOG_LEVEL=error
HOLDOR_TENANT=noviel

Onboarding: Crashfall Pipeline (security review). Crashfall ingests crash dumps from the Lintbird mobile app, strips device identifiers, and forwards symbolicated reports to the Quillstone triage queue. Ingest workers run in an isolated subnet; egress is allowlisted to the symbol store only. Workers authenticate to the symbol store with a signing token loaded from the env file. Add the following line to .env.crashfall:

vault entry, baweg-hahog: COURIER_KEY5=337d5

If users report the new Brimble consent banner looping or blocking checkout, don't panic — it's usually a cached policy version. First, have them hard-refresh; if that fails, check the rollout dashboard to see whether their region is in the Velora cohort. Anything affecting more than ~20 users in 15 minutes should be escalated straight to the banner squad, not general platform on-call. Tag the ticket with "consent-rollout" so it hits the right queue. For direct escalation outside business hours, reach the squad here.

alerts address for kajog-tadup: druox@plorvanet.internal